Important Questions to Ask

To help in your selection of a venue keep in mind that there are many elements that need to come together to make your day special. Meet with the banquet manager and anyone that will be handling your wedding on the day itself and in the preparations. You need to be able to work with these people in order for your wedding to run smoothly. Enough said! Ask, of course, about the availability of the room, dates and times, and is there any allowances for overtime. What is the room capacity. Too big or too small can create an uncomfortable atmosphere. Is there a place for the ceremony if you wish to have it there, and is there a separate room for the cocktail hour. Look at all the rooms that you are considering and ask if any renovations are to be made around the time of your wedding. Ask if any other events will be going on at the same time; this is important with regards to parking and bathroom facilities. With regards to parking, is it valet or not? Will the bathroom have an attendant? Is there a coat check?

Style, Theme, and Location

Your wedding date is set, so the first basic decisions to tackle are style, theme, and location. Budget plays a part in these decisions too, and of course should be considered. Style and location of your event will influence the cost. Formal events in urban areas tend to be more expensive, so that’s where your research can pay off. Word of mouth, Yellow Pages, and the Internet are your best friends during your engagement. Tackle the biggest issues first: choosing a location for your ceremony and reception. If you are using a familiar house of worship this is your first place to start confirming dates.

Time Frame

When you decide to get married, THE DATE, becomes all important.

You need a certain amount of time to accomplish all that a wedding involves.

Venues become booked early, and even churches need adequate notice. If you are working under a time restraint you should be willing to be more open-minded, and less picky. You may also be forced to spend more money since research and bargain hunting will be limited.

Incorporating elements of the season that you are marrying in may save you money but feel free to mix and match your favorite details. Each season brings its own beauty and obstacles when planning a wedding, but after deciding on a date, you can choose to have a seasonal theme wedding, or do as you please.

When choosing a wedding date remember that details don’t just happen and it is better to have plenty of time to research and plan so that you can feel confident about providing your guests with a memorable time as well as enjoying your special day.
